The Folded Optics Market was valued at USD 1.52 billion in 2023 and is projected to grow to USD 1.70 billion in 2024, with a CAGR of 11.71%, reaching USD 3.32 billion by 2030.
KEY MARKET STATISTICS | |
---|---|
Base Year [2023] | USD 1.52 billion |
Estimated Year [2024] | USD 1.70 billion |
Forecast Year [2030] | USD 3.32 billion |
CAGR (%) | 11.71% |
Folded optics represents a significant evolution in optical system design, fostering improved miniaturization and versatility in applications that span from consumer electronics to critical defense systems. This emerging field has rapidly gained attention as device manufacturers and technology innovators seek to integrate advanced optical solutions that reduce space without compromising performance.
The market has been increasingly driven by the need for devices that are both compact and high performing, allowing for more sophisticated functionality in smaller form factors. The utilization of folded optics simplifies complex optical paths into more efficient, leverageable designs. Initially inspired by the demands of mobile devices and digital imaging, the advancements in folded optics are now being leveraged across a broad spectrum of sectors. The convergence of smart engineering and innovative material science continues to push the boundaries of what is possible in today's competitive market.
This overview sets the stage for a detailed exploration of the evolving market dynamics, key segmentation, and the regional as well as company-specific insights that collectively shape the future of folded optics. The focus is on providing a balanced narrative that links technological innovation with market demand, ultimately offering a vivid picture of a market poised for significant growth in both volume and complexity.

Key Segmentation Insights Shaping Market Dynamics
The segmentation of the folded optics market offers a granular understanding of its dynamic nature, highlighting distinct areas that contribute to overall growth. The segmentation based on technology reveals critical insights as the market is studied across diffractive folded optics, reflective folded optics, and refractive folded optics. This technological differentiation is important, given that each method offers unique benefits in terms of light manipulation, efficiency, and integration complexity.
In parallel, the segmentation based on material type provides an insightful perspective by categorizing the landscape into ceramics, glass, and plastic. The choice of material is a crucial determinant for performance and durability in various operating environments, influencing both the optical quality and the ruggedness of the final product. Each material type interacts differently with light, and their intrinsic properties lead to variations in manufacturing techniques and market appeal.
Further segmentation based on application segments illustrates how folded optics are integrated into diverse industries. The automotive sector increasingly incorporates these optical systems for enhanced imaging and sensing capabilities that contribute to advanced driving systems and safety features. Meanwhile, in the realm of consumer electronics, folded optics find a robust role in the design of smartphones, tablets, and wearables, thereby underpinning the compactness and efficiency demanded by modern handheld devices.
The defense and security application domain leverages folded optical systems by incorporating them into night vision goggles and surveillance drones. These devices require not just miniaturization but also the capacity to perform reliably under extreme conditions, making the role of advanced optics indispensable. In the medical sector, innovations in folded optics are transforming diagnostic imaging and endoscopes, where high precision and reliability are obligatory. The nuanced approach to each segmentation emphasizes the diverse utility of these optical systems and delineates future opportunities for market players to innovate and cater to specialized needs.
